Remote Inside Sales Representative
Company: Liberty Mutual Insurance
Location: Chevy Chase, MD
Posted Jan 24, 2025
Liberty Mutual is offering a Remote Inside Sales Agent position with a starting base salary of $45K, with potential earnings ranging from $55K-$75K through base salary and commission. Top performers can earn up to $85K+. The role involves handling inbound calls and warm leads, consulting with customers on their insurance needs, and converting sales leads into policyholders. Paid training is provided, including licensing in all 50 states. The company values qualities like positivity, flexibility, determination, and a persuasive personality. Qualifications include 2-3 years of sales experience, strong interpersonal and persuasion skills, excellent analytical and organizational skills, and PC proficiency. Liberty Mutual is committed to fostering a diverse, equitable, and inclusive workplace.
Associate Claims Specialist, Workers Compensation - West Region
Company: Liberty Mutual Insurance
Location: Los Angeles, CA
Posted Jan 24, 2025
The Associate Claims Specialist role at Liberty Mutual involves managing a caseload of claims, from investigation to resolution. This includes determining liability, evaluating losses, and negotiating settlements. The role requires a Bachelor's degree and 1-year claims handling experience. Comprehensive training is provided, including a mandatory one-week travel period to Plano, TX. Candidates residing near Lake Oswego, OR; Chandler, AZ; or Rocklin, CA must work in the office twice monthly. Those in Los Angeles or Orange County can work remotely. The company values diversity, equity, and inclusion, offering comprehensive benefits and learning opportunities.

Workers' Compensation Attorney
Company: Liberty Mutual Insurance
Location: Denver, CO
Posted Jan 24, 2025
Liberty Mutual is offering an exciting opportunity for a Workers' Compensation Attorney admitted and residing in Colorado. The role is primarily remote and involves handling a caseload of workers' compensation matters, conducting depositions, and representing Liberty Mutual and its policyholders at WC hearings. The attorney will also interact with Liberty Mutual's Workers' Compensation claims organization. The company values a healthy work/life balance and offers benefits such as eligible performance bonuses, 20 days of flexible time off, personal holidays, a pension plan, and a 401(k) plan with matching contributions. The ideal candidate should have a minimum of five years' experience as an attorney, preferably with Workers' Compensation experience, and be a member of the Colorado State Bar. They should also possess strong working relationships skills, analytical thinking, and proficiency with technologies that reduce costs and facilitate remote work.
